Where next for skills?: how business-led upskilling can reboot Australia
Australia has moved through the 'shock' phase of the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ic and is now beginning the management phase that involves secondary outbreaks. Governments are actively seeking to minimise the risk of business failure and business-specific skills loss through a range of general interventions (e.g. JobKeeper) and other skills-specific interventions (e.g. JobTrainer and Supporting Apprentices and Trainees wage subsidy).
